用java语言定义一个三角形类 Triangle , 各位帮个忙!
用java语言定义一个三角形类Triangle。1)属性:三边a,b,c2)方法:A构造方法,初始化三边B计算周长的方法C计算面积的方法D判断三边是否构成三角形的方法要用...
用java语言定义一个三角形类 Triangle。
1)属性:三边a,b,c
2)方法:
A 构造方法,初始化三边
B 计算周长的方法
C 计算面积的方法
D 判断三边是否构成三角形的方法
要用上以下的公式
海伦公式(面积):
s=1.0/2*(a+b+c);
面积 = Math.sqrt(s*(s-a)*(s-b)*(s-c));
本人新手,跪求代码,谢谢各位! 展开
1)属性:三边a,b,c
2)方法:
A 构造方法,初始化三边
B 计算周长的方法
C 计算面积的方法
D 判断三边是否构成三角形的方法
要用上以下的公式
海伦公式(面积):
s=1.0/2*(a+b+c);
面积 = Math.sqrt(s*(s-a)*(s-b)*(s-c));
本人新手,跪求代码,谢谢各位! 展开
展开全部
public class Triangle
{
int a;
int b;
int c;
public Triangle(int a, int b, int c){
this.a = a;
this.b = b;
this.c = c;
}
public int getZhouChang(){
return a + b + c;
}
public double getArea(){
double area;
double s;
s=1.0/2*(a+b+c);
area = Math.sqrt(s*(s-a)*(s-b)*(s-c));
return area;
}
public boolean isTriangle(){
if(a + b > c || a + c > b || b + c > a){
return true;
}else{
return false;
}
}
}
采纳吧 打字辛苦的
{
int a;
int b;
int c;
public Triangle(int a, int b, int c){
this.a = a;
this.b = b;
this.c = c;
}
public int getZhouChang(){
return a + b + c;
}
public double getArea(){
double area;
double s;
s=1.0/2*(a+b+c);
area = Math.sqrt(s*(s-a)*(s-b)*(s-c));
return area;
}
public boolean isTriangle(){
if(a + b > c || a + c > b || b + c > a){
return true;
}else{
return false;
}
}
}
采纳吧 打字辛苦的
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询